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S)


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S) or sometimes called Multimedia Messaging System is a communications technology developed by 3GPP (Third Generation Partnership Project) that allows users to exchange multimedia communications between capable mobile phones and other devices.

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S) allows for non-real-time transmission of various kinds of multimedia contents, such as images, audio, and video clips. It is an extension to the Short Message Service (SMS) protocol, MMS defines a way to almost instantaneously send and receive wireless messages that include images, audio, and video clips in addition to text. When the technology has been fully developed, it will support the transmission of streaming video. A common current application of MMS messaging is picture messaging (the use of camera phones to take photos for immediate delivery to a mobile recipient). Other possibilities include animations and graphic presentations of stock quotes, sports news, and weather reports.
